Yooka-Replaylee Announced By Playtonic

And it's coming to "Nintendo" platforms...?
By Todd BlackOctober 24, 2024
Yooka-Replaylee

A classic thing that happens in the gaming industry is key members of a certain development team leaving the situation they’re in to make something different. Or, something they actually want to make. When certain members of the Banjo-Kazooie team left Rare to make Playtonic, they decided to create a game called Yooka-Laylee to be a spiritual successor to what came before. Fast forward to now, and they’ve announced an improved and enhanced version of the game called Yooka-Replaylee, and you can wishlist it now.

As noted by the game’s pages,  Yooka-Replaylee isn’t just a simple remastering of the 2017 title. Instead, it’s one that features new elements to the game, reworked puzzles, and quality-of-life features that many have been asking for since the game’s release years back.

One of the more curious elements of the tweet above is the note that the game will be on “Nintendo” systems. That seems to imply that the game will be on Switch 2 when it releases next year. To that end, Playtonic’s enhanced title doesn’t have a release date just yet, but that will likely change soon enough.
